What is BS EN 4652-410 - Straight plug coaxial connectors about ?
BS EN 4652-410 specifies the characteristics of bayonet coupling (C interface) coaxial right-angle plugs − 50 ohms. The cable-to-connector assembly is a clamp technology.
BS EN 4652-410 covers the terms and definitions, required characteristics, qualification, designation, markings, packaging, storage, and technical specifications of the radiofrequency connector with a straight plug for use in electrical systems of aircraft.
BS EN 4652-410 has been prepared by the Aerospace and Defence Industries Association of Europe - Standardization (ASD-STAN).

Why should you use BS EN 4652 -410 - Straight plug coaxial connectors ?
The C connector is a type of RF connector used for terminating coaxial cable. The interface specifications for the C and many other connectors are referenced in MIL-STD-348. The connector uses two-stud bayonet-type locks. It is weatherproof without being overly bulky. The mating arrangement is similar to that of the BNC connector.
